发明名称 ULTRASONIC DIAGNOSTIC DEVICE, IMAGE PROCESSING DEVICE, AND IMAGE PROCESSING METHOD
摘要 According to one embodiment, an ultrasonic diagnostic device includes a first rendering unit, a second rendering unit, a superimposition processing unit, a display control unit. The first rendering unit generates a first rendering image according to a first rendering method based on volume data collected by three-dimensionally scanning a subject with ultrasonic waves. The second rendering unit generates a second rendering image according to a second rendering method that is different from the first rendering method, based on the volume data. The superimposition processing unit generates a superimposed image in which at least a part of the first rendering image and a part of the second rendering image are superimposed on each other. The display control unit causes a display device to display the superimposed image. The superimposition processing unit adjusts a superimposition ratio of the first and second rendering images in the superimposed image.
